New RV park Camp in Airstream South 77 opens in Aichi Prefecture
Original source: 月刊自家用車WEB - 厳選クルマ情報

In Brief

A paid RV park, Camp in Airstream South 77, has opened on the Chita Peninsula in Aichi Prefecture, Japan. Overnight stays start at 5000 yen, with electricity, water and a 24-hour toilet available.

A new RV park for motorhomes and campers, Camp in Airstream South 77, has opened in Aichi Prefecture, Japan. Located on the Chita Peninsula in the city of Minamichita, the park combines sea views with an American vintage theme.

The park offers overnight parking spaces based on vintage Airstream trailers. Rates start at 5000 yen per night. Facilities include electricity, water and a 24-hour toilet.

The new park aims to provide an alternative to regular parking lots, where long-term parking is often prohibited.

RV Park ASAHI Opens in Aomori: Private Motorhome Parking in Residential Area

RV Park ASAHI has opened in Aomori City, offering paid overnight parking for motorhomes with 4 spaces. Located in a residential area, it is 15 minutes from the ferry terminal to Hakodate. Rates start at 3,700 yen per night.

Blogger highlights need for portable power stations based on 2011 earthquake experience

Miri Kyodera, who survived the 2011 Great East Japan Earthquake and lived in a car with her dog for about two months, shared her experience of electricity shortage. She noted that food and water can be stockpiled or received as aid, but electricity does not arrive immediately during a blackout. In 2016, she bought an Anker PowerHouse portable power station and has been running a specialized blog on portable power since 2018, testing over 90 devices.

Magnitude 7 earthquake in Kumamoto: Yatsushiro sees collapsed houses, car camping and heat concerns

A day after a magnitude 7 earthquake struck Kumamoto Prefecture, the city of Yatsushiro (intensity 6+) reported numerous collapsed houses. Many residents are sleeping in cars due to the heat in evacuation centers without air conditioning. Roads near the epicenter are buckled, power and water are cut, and gas stations and convenience stores are closed. Authorities warn of heatstroke and economy class syndrome among those staying in vehicles.

Summer car sleeping: 6 safety tips for disaster situations

Blogger Katō Yoshiya published guidelines for safe overnight stays in vehicles during summer disasters. Key points include strict heatstroke prevention using sunshades and air conditioning, prevention of economy class syndrome (thrombosis) through frequent leg movement and hydration, carbon monoxide poisoning prevention when idling the engine, proper sleeping posture with elevated feet, security and privacy measures (door locks, curtains), and choosing a safe parking spot away from flood zones, landslides, and direct sunlight.
